What is a Certified Door Installer?
A certified door installer has actually undergone particular training and assessment to show their efficiency in door installation. Certification might come from makers, industry associations, or trade companies that ensure the installer sticks to acknowledged standards in workmanship and security. These professionals are equipped to manage various kinds of doors, including residential, commercial, and specialized options such as fire-rated and hurricane-resistant doors.

Comprehending the actions involved in door installation can help house owners value the skill required from certified installers. Here is a summary of the common door installation process:

Assessment and Measurement
Assess the existing door frame, measurements, and any needed repairs.Discuss the preferred door type, design, and material with the house owner.
Preparing the Site
Remove the old door and frame, if required, while making sure the surrounding area is secured.Conduct any required repair work to the frame or structure.
Installation
Set up the door frame if it's a brand-new door.Position the door properly in the frame, ensuring it is level and plumb.Secure the door with hinges and examine its operation.
Finishing Touches
Seal spaces with weather condition removing or caulk to enhance energy efficiency.Add any hardware such as handles and locks.Tidy up the installation website and make sure everything functions smoothly.Elements to Consider When Choosing a Certified Door Installer
